Nestled in downtown, this modern hotel boasts spacious rooms, a lively bar, and inviting poolside vibes, perfect for a memorable stay in Abu Dhabi.

Over the past four weeks, my wife and I have hopped between four different hotels in Abu Dhabi, including a Wyndham property that delivered exactly what you’d expect—solid, predictable quality. But then we decided to throw caution to the wind and try this "unknown" little gem. Why? Its proximity to Hamdan Center—a spot we hold dear for nostalgic strolls and bargain hunts. And boy, did this place blow us away! First off, the staff? Absolute rockstars. Genuinely kind and attentive without that forced politeness you sometimes get. The room? Small, sure, but packed with everything you need and surprisingly modern for a non-chain hotel. Bonus points for having CNN on the TV—finally, something other than endless free-to-air channels! Their toiletries didn’t make me feel like I was auditioning for a "chemical burns survivor" show, and the amenities were spot on for a short stay. The only downside? The gym was hotter than a desert barbecue thanks to the lack of A/C or windows. Thankfully, winter saved the day, but I wouldn’t want to try it in summer unless I was training for a sauna endurance competition. Checkout was a breeze—ten seconds flat with a cheerful reminder to double-check for forgotten items. That final farewell sealed the deal—they’ll definitely be seeing us again. This place is the blueprint for budget hotels done right: fantastic service, spotless rooms, all the essentials, loads of parking, and a location that’s as convenient as it gets. Five stars all the way—and not just because of CNN!
